The Cyclops Polyphemus
On his way back from the Trojan War, Odysseus and his army land on the island of Polyphemus, who is a Cyclops, a one-eyed giant son of Poseidon and Thoosa in Greek mythology. It is one of the instrumental characters that define the course of the film and the journey of Odysseus

The Sirens
Apart from Polyphemus, the Sirens are also the most fascinating characters that you will encounter on another island in the film. The creature is known to be dangerous as they enchant sailors and lure them towards their deaths

Circe
One of the other most fascinating creatures is the enchantress Circe, who is known to be very powerful, and when Odysseus and his men come on her island, she turns them into pigs, to depict the greed of men

Scylla and Charybdis
After passing the Sirens, Odysseus and his crew meet the two terrifying monsters in the sea - Scylla and Charybdis. While Scylla is the six-headed beast depicted as a mountain, Charybdis is a enormous and dangerous whirpool
